Land clearing services involve the removal of trees, brush, stumps, and other vegetation to prepare a property for development, landscaping, or new construction. This process often includes grading and debris removal to create a clean, level area suitable for building projects, gardens, or recreational spaces.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to efficiently clear the land while minimizing disturbance to the surrounding environment. Homeowners considering additions such as new garages, patios, or fencing may find land clearing essential to ensure a safe and functional foundation.

These services help solve common problems associated with overgrown or uneven terrain, such as obstructed views, limited access, or potential hazards like fallen branches or unstable ground. Clearing a property can also reduce the risk of pests and fire hazards by removing excess brush and dead vegetation. For those planning to install new features or improve drainage, land clearing creates a blank slate that makes subsequent work easier and more effective. It is especially useful when transforming neglected or wooded areas into usable outdoor spaces.

Properties that frequently utilize land clearing include residential lots, especially those with dense trees or thick underbrush, as well as vacant land intended for future development. Rural properties, farms, and estates often require clearing to manage land for agriculture or livestock. Commercial properties preparing for new construction or landscaping projects also benefit from professional clearing services. The overview below groups typical Land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mount Dora,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Land Clearing Projects - For routine jobs like clearing a small backyard or garden,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many smaller j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and complexity of the area.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Medium-Scale Land Clearing - Larger lots or properties requiring more extensive clearing us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. This range covers most typical residential projects in the Mount Dora area. Larger or more dense sites may push costs higher but remain within this band.

Heavy Land Clearing and Brush Removal - For extensive brush removal or site preparation on larger parcels, prices generally range from $3,500 to $7,000. Many projects in this category fall into the middle of this range, with fewer reaching the highest tiers unless conditions are particularly challenging.

Full Land Clearing or Site Preparation - Complete clearing of large properties or sites with complex terrain can cost $8,000 and above. Such projects are less common and tend to be at the upper end of the price spectrum, depending on the scope and site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is land clearing? Land clearing involves removing trees, brush, and debris to prepare a property for development, landscaping, or agricultural use in Mount Dora, FL and nearby areas.

Why should I consider professional land clearing services? Professionals have the equipment and experience to efficiently clear land while minimizing potential damage and ensuring safety.

What types of land clearing methods are available? Methods can include mechanical removal with machinery, controlled burning, or mulching, depending on the site and project needs.

How do local contractors handle debris after land clearing? Many service providers offer debris removal or mulching options to leave the site clean and ready for the next phase.
